With regard to pre-notification, have you given any thought to extending the time allowed for communities to decide whether they want to act on a transfer of land? There has been a lot of feedback from communities saying that the time allowed is simply not long enough for them to do that, or that there should at least be a period of time in which they can register an interest and then do some more work, or say that they are not interested, with the sale therefore allowed to go ahead.

That seems to be fair. There has also been discussion about compensation and “hope value”, and I can understand why. If a tenant were to have done something, resumption could mean the owner making a profit from somebody else’s endeavours. If the hope value were available to tenants to realise, would that need to be considered when looking at compensation—for example, if the tenant could do the development that the landowner intends to do and profit from it themselves?
